Adam Henrique and Josh Anderson stay within the rumor mill

The Fourth Period: Two gamers within the rumor mill are Anaheim Ducks ahead Adam Henrique and Montreal Canadiens ahead Josh Anderson.

Henrique has a 10-team no-trade checklist and has yet another 12 months left on his five-year, $29.125 million deal. Anderson has an eight-team no-trade and 4 years left on his seven-year, $38.5 million deal.


With solely a 12 months left on his deal and having a good season, he would possibly draw some curiosity.

The Calgary Flames, Edmonton Oilers, and New Jersey Devils have proven some curiosity in Anderson. A supply mentioned that the Oilers and Devils is probably not practical. The asking value is excessive so it is probably not straightforward to maneuver him.
